        Embedded DevCon detailed agenda released

        Doug | Date: Jun 14, 2004 | Comments: 1



        Microsoft has released the detailed daily agenda for the upcoming Windows Embedded Developers' Conference in San Diego from June 28 to July 1. This is Microsoft's fourth annual Windows Embedded DevCon, bringing developers face-to-face with the Windows Embedded development team.




        Two introductory pre-conference tutorials kick things off on Monday, June 28. The morning session introduces Windows XP Embedded, while the afternoon session covers Windows CE .NET. The technical sessions, beginning on Tuesday, are split into four tracks:
        • Building Windows CE-based devices
        • Building Windows XP Embedded-based devices
        • Application development for both CE .NET and XP Embedded
        • Mobility and other topics
